Two different counties, plumbing-wise

The split that matters here is not really geographic, it is whether a property is on a public water system or its own well. Inside the city and the boroughs there are public systems, and the utility handles supply and quality up to the property line.

Across the rural townships, households run their own pumps, pressure tanks and treatment, and nobody tests that water but the owner. Tell us which you are on when you call, because it changes what we bring and what we are likely to be looking at.

Not Mt. Lebanon

Worth stating plainly, because search results mix the two up constantly. This is Lebanon County in Central Pennsylvania, between Harrisburg and Reading.

Mt. Lebanon is a separate municipality in Allegheny County, roughly 200 miles west outside Pittsburgh. If that is where you are, we cannot reach you and you will want a plumber local to there.
